Questions & Answers
Q: Why did Barnes & Noble shares drop significantly?
Barnes & Noble's shares plummeted as Liberty Media sold the majority stake due to the declining Nook business, prompting concerns about the company's future in the market.
Q: Why is Yelp facing challenges?
Yelp is facing challenges due to the power of negative reviews outweighing positive feedback, leading to FTC complaints and the need for process adjustments to maintain user trust.
Q: What is Plug Power's recent acquisition strategy?
Plug Power's purchase of a fuel cell tech company for all stock was seen as a smart move, but concerns remain about the high price-to-sales ratio and lack of significant sales growth.
Q: What can investors expect from CarMax's upcoming earnings report?
Investors in CarMax can anticipate insights on unit sales performance and potential impacts of weather conditions on car shopping, offering valuable information for market evaluation.
